Love is Blind Sweden Reveals the Premiere Date and Jessica Almenäs as Host for the Reality Dating Show

Netflix can today reveal the premiere date and the host for Love is Blind Sweden. The TV presenter Jessica Almenäs will be the host for the Swedish version of the Netflix dating series Love is Blind which will premiere on January 12, 2024. The series follows a social experiment where singles look for love and to get engaged, all before meeting in person.

"I am so excited to be a part of this fascinating and completely unique experiment. I have been a big Love is Blind fan ever since the first season aired in the US. It feels fantastic that I now have the opportunity to host the Swedish version and be there to support our brave participants. For a hopeless romantic like me, it's a dream job," says Jessica Almenäs.

Jessica Almenäs is a Swedish television presenter and reporter and has previously hosted shows such as Let's Dance (Strictly Come Dancing), Biggest Loser and Superstars.

About Love is Blind Sweden

In Love is Blind, singles who want to be loved for who they are on the inside will choose someone to marry without seeing them. Over the next four weeks, they'll move in together, plan their wedding, and attempt to add a physical connection to their emotional bond. When their wedding day arrives, will they marry the person they fell blindly in love with? Or have the physical realities and external factors sabotaged their relationship?

Format: Starting January 12, 2024, new episodes of Love is Blind Sweden will roll out each Friday across 10 episodes, following the singles' journeys for love:

Batch 1 - January 12, 2024 (4 episodes)

Batch 2 - January 19, 2024 (4 episodes)

Batch 3 - January 26, 2024 (The Weddings)

Batch 4 - To be announced (Reunion)

Production Company: Mastiff

Producers: Anna Nygren & Elias Malmberg

Line Producer: Mia Joelsson

Executive Producer: Caroline Claesson, Andreas Johansson, Mattias Olsson & Matilda Snöwall

Love is Blind Sweden is set to be released globally on Netflix on January 12, 2024.
